Golf: Augustus Finishes T3rd On Moon Light Tour

Golf: Augustus Finishes T3rd On Moon Light Tour

Daniel Augustus recently took to the Champions Gate Golf Course in Florida to play in the Moon Light Golf Tour International Round. Augustus finished T3rd after a Round of 73; finishing level with Dominic Mancinelli and Cameron Beal. Sports Minister Congratulates Sakari Famous

Sports Minister Congratulates Sakari Famous

The Minister of Labour, Community Affairs and Sports Lovitta Foggo today [Jan 15] congratulated Bermuda’s Sakari Famous on breaking the National Indoor Women’s High Jump Record over the weekend. Football: Columbus Crew Draft Justin Donawa

Football: Columbus Crew Draft Justin Donawa

Bermuda’s Justin Donawa was selected 66th overall in the 2019 Major League Soccer SuperDraft by the Columbus Crew, a professional football team based out of Ohio. Freisenbruch-Meyer Continental Bowling Results

Freisenbruch-Meyer Continental Bowling Results

In Freisenbruch-Meyer Continental Bowling League action at the Warwick Lanes saw the Nifty Rollers defeat the Bermuda Pest Control 21 – 9, New Hope defeated Quickie Lickie Laundry 18.5 – 11.5, while the Spicenix defeated the Pinjammers 17 – 13.
